Frustrated at the failure of India's government and opposition to argue the case for economic reforms they both advocate in theory, one of the country's leading think-tanks has taken to the streets-with comics. The Rajiv Gandhi Foundation has just launched the first in a didactic series aimed at persuading ordinary Indians that economic reform will improve their standard of living and help make India a decent and just society, a case the timid political class has let go by default, fearing that liberalisation costs votes.
